New Health Warning: New picture from December on the pack of tobacco products, it will be written 'It is the cause of painful death'


Posted on 29th Jul 2022 02:14 pm by rohit kumar

A big step is being taken to raise awareness against tobacco products, which are becoming a major cause of deadly diseases like cancer. Tobacco products manufactured, imported, or packaged in the country on or after December 1, 2022, will have a new warning.

 

A new warning on the pack of tobacco products will be written as 'Tobacco causes a painful death. The Union Health Ministry has issued a notification to publish a new picture on the pack of products manufactured from tobacco from December 1, 2022. This rule will be valid for one year.

 

The notification also said that a picture with a health warning shall be displayed on tobacco products manufactured or imported or packaged on or after December 1, 2023, for the next year. It will be written as a warning, 'Tobacco users die at a young age.

 

The Ministry amended the Cigarettes and Other Tobacco Products (Packaging and Labelling) Rules, 2008 on July 21. Accordingly, this notification has been issued regarding new health warnings. It said that the amended rules under the Cigarettes and Other Tobacco Products (Packaging and Labelling) Third Amendment Rules, 2022 will come into force from December 1, 2022. Violation of rules will be considered a punishable offense

 

The government said that violation of these guidelines would be a punishable offense. It provides for imprisonment or fine under section 20 of the Cigarettes and Other Tobacco Products (Prohibition of Advertising and Regulation of Trade and Commerce, Production, Supply, and Distribution) Act, 2003.
